Transaction 62a61929210ffd53829ea2c17e50ca3d72d442954fa10c66b45221ca06237891
1 Input
1 Output
-
62a61929210ffd53829ea2c17e50ca3d72d442954fa10c66b45221ca06237891:0
- value
- 10803874
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38e411632dac54984f137bb9aaa1597d3ed627a1 OP_EQUAL
- address
- MD5yHcJnU9rkUxr29tD9ocmd1yog65TS2c